Notice
● Close all the doors before adjusting the settings. While a door of the refrigerator is opened or an indicator lamp on the display is blinking, it will not
work even if you push the Control Panel.
● To confi rm settings, open the refrigerator door or push any button. The indicator lamps become lit again.
● The indicator lamp on the Control Panel will be unlit for energy saving about 40 seconds after operation. However, indicator lamps such as " Freezer " ,
" Fredge " , " Save " , " Trip " , " Quick " , " Off " , " Water " and " eco operation " will not be turned off.
● When opening the refrigerator door, the displayed characters become lit. They become unlit about 15 seconds after closing it.

Providing information
It will be illuminated automatically to show that energy saving
mode including Frost Recycle Cooling and others is set to ON
when it is operating under the low power consumption.
Notice
If it is not illuminated, it may be due to the following reason.
・ Immediately after installation or when plentiful foods are stored at a time
・ When the door is opened/closed frequently or the door is not closed completely
・ It is set to " Freezer " , " Fredge " , " Quick " , or " Veg " .
・ When the ambient temperature around the refrigerator is about 35˚C or higher.
